Digital Target ID Systems
Digital Target ID systems translate electromagnetic signals into actionable data that separates valuable finds from trash.
You’ll encounter numeric scales from 0-99, where ferrous junk registers below 40 and desirable non-ferrous targets exceed that threshold. Digital target accuracy depends on your detector’s resolution—eight-segment systems like the Teknetics Delta 4000 outperform basic models in trashy environments.
Audio tone differentiation enhances your efficiency; five-tone configurations let you identify targets without checking the display. The Fisher F75 demonstrates this precision, showing iron at 4-12 and silver dollars at 91.
You’ll maximize discrimination control by understanding how target size, depth, and orientation affect readings. Targets positioned flat against the ground produce clearer signal responses than those angled on their edges, directly impacting ID accuracy. Advanced models like the CTX 3030 provide two-dimensional ID graphs that separate conductivity from ferrous content, eliminating guesswork in challenging conditions.
Ground mineralization levels can significantly impact the reliability of your target ID readings, requiring calibration adjustments in heavily mineralized soil conditions.
Multi-Frequency Detection Technology
Multi frequency benefits include enhanced depth on small targets, automatic soil adaptation that reduces manual ground balancing, and exceptional target separation in trashy sites.
Models like the Nokta Legend (4-40 kHz) and Garrett’s 5-50 kHz systems deliver stable performance in wet sand, clay, and rocky terrain.
You won’t sacrifice shallow sensitivity for depth—simultaneous transmission maintains both, giving you unrestricted capability across challenging conditions without compromising your efficiency or results.
Simultaneous multi-frequency technology transmits and analyzes multiple frequencies at once, allowing you to find all target types in a single sweep rather than switching between modes.
Professional detectors operating from 5 kHz to 75 kHz can even identify non-metallic conductive materials like carbon rods and fine wires that single-frequency units miss.

Automatic Ground Balance Features
Automatic ground balance separates productive detecting sessions from frustrating signal chaos in mineralized soil. This feature delivers automatic calibration that neutralizes ground minerals without technical expertise, giving you freedom to hunt anywhere.
You’ll press one button, pump your coil 4-6 times, and the detector handles the rest—typically accurate within 1-2 digits of ideal settings.
User convenience advantages in affordable detectors:
- One-touch operation eliminates manual tuning on beaches, fields, and parks where mineralization varies
- Instant setup gets you hunting in 30 seconds versus 5+ minutes of manual adjustment
- Reliable performance in light-to-moderate soil conditions without constant recalibration
Start each session with auto ground balance before discrimination adjustments.
You’ll maximize target depth while eliminating false signals that waste your valuable hunting time.

Choosing Detectors for Specific Hunting Environments

How does terrain dictate your detector’s performance? Your environment demands specific technologies to maximize finds and eliminate false signals.
Match these detectors to your hunting grounds:
1. Beach hunting – You’ll need multi-frequency technology like Minelab X-Terra Pro’s Beach mode or Pulse Induction for saltwater mineralization.
Garrett AT Pro handles wet sand discrimination up to 10 feet depth.
2. Gold prospecting – High-frequency VLF (Garrett Goldmaster 24K at 48 kHz) detects small nuggets in mild soil.
Mineralized terrain requires PI technology—Garrett Axiom Lite delivers affordable Ultra-Pulse performance through hot rocks and iron-rich ground.
3. Parks and fields – Basic VLF with preset modes suffices.
Garrett Ace 300’s concentric coil covers ground efficiently in low-mineral soil.
Terra-Scan and automatic ground balancing adapt to changing conditions, giving you freedom to hunt anywhere without constant manual adjustments.
Important Accessories and Warranty Coverage
Beyond selecting the right detector, your field success depends on purpose-built accessories that minimize recovery time and protect your investment.
Pinpointers like the Garrett Pro-Pointer AT or Minelab Pro-Find 35 deliver precise target isolation through tone and vibration, cutting excavation time considerably. Quality headphones block ambient noise for faint signal detection while extending battery performance. For recovery, Lesche brand trowels feature depth marks and serrated edges that slice through roots effortlessly.
Your accessory recommendations should include finds pouches with MOLLE compatibility and sand scoops for beach environments.

How Do I Properly Maintain and Clean My Metal Detector?
Though it seems tedious, you’ll maximize your detector’s performance by wiping components with microfiber cleaning tools after each hunt, rinsing coils post-saltwater use, and ensuring proper detector storage in cool, dry conditions while removing batteries between sessions.
What Are the Best Techniques for Recovering Buried Targets Safely?
You’ll master target recovery by using pinpointing modes before excavation, then employing proper digging techniques like horseshoe plugs and handheld pinpointers. Always rescan holes, minimize ground disturbance, and restore sites completely—preserving your detecting freedom and access rights.
